Note: When set in Relay mode the TX will not allow selection of video/audio encoder or data
modes (they are forced to OFF) until the unit is no longer in relay mode.
A Digital Relay system can be made by using the chaining interface. A relay uses a
receiver to receive the digital signal on one frequency, and then uses the transmitter to
re-modulate the signal onto another frequency. This technique has the following
advantages:
Maintains Video Quality
Does not increase delay
Maintains encryption.
CAUTION: On the transmitter, you must set up a modulation bit rate which is equal to or
greater than the ASI bit rate coming in. If the ASI bit rate exceeds the modulation bit rate
the link won’t work and you’ll see an Overflow message in the Unit Information page.
Before you Begin
You’ll need:
A Receiver with ASI out capability
A Transmitter
A Chaining Cable
A PC with the Transmitter Controller software loaded
A CA0343-2 USB to Lemo communications cable.
